CLEAR ANSWERS TO COMMON QUESTIONS

Frequently Asked Questions

What does this quiz measure?
It measures knowledge of where major civilizations, historic cities, migration routes, and landmarks are located worldwide. Items rely on historical-geography knowledge and reasoning from physical and political geography.
What format do the questions use?
Each item provides a text description with location and physical-geography clues. Responses are based on borders, seas, rivers, landforms, and present-day country locations rather than an interactive map.
How long does it take to complete?
Most respondents finish in about 10 minutes. Completion time may vary by familiarity with world geography and history.
How many questions are included and what regions are covered?
The quiz contains 16 questions. Content spans Africa, Asia, Europe, Oceania, and the Americas.
How is the score reported?
The final score summarizes overall accuracy across all items. It reflects general world history map knowledge rather than performance in one region or time period.
